fpga multiple driver nets
时间: 2024-05-30 19:11:14 浏览: 29
FPGA Multiple Driver Nets (MDNs) refer to situations where multiple drivers are connected to a single net in an FPGA. This can occur when multiple output pins or logic blocks are connected to the same signal net. It is important to avoid creating MDNs in FPGA designs because they can cause unpredictable behavior and timing issues.
When multiple drivers are connected to the same net, they can create contention issues where one driver attempts to drive the signal high while another driver tries to drive it low. This can result in signal glitches, noise, or even damage to the FPGA.
To avoid MDNs, designers can use techniques such as bus architectures, tri-state buffers, or other multiplexing techniques to ensure that only one driver is active on a net at any given time. Additionally, FPGA design tools often have built-in checks and warnings to alert designers to potential MDN issues during the design process.